Output e1c8476ac5e5b5b42d522bbbdc75df1d6cdb026b0d1176db17e21519e40a89d2:5

value
19131
script pubkey
OP_HASH160 OP_PUSHBYTES_20 39051c364ca41f84f9158a92be7fd9578fdd1a1b OP_EQUAL
address
36tWZYM2v7WMq8rcK7twYbX4PxMiePfz7c
transaction
e1c8476ac5e5b5b42d522bbbdc75df1d6cdb026b0d1176db17e21519e40a89d2
confirmations
235892
spent
true